## Changelog — Quillbarrow test harness 3.2

Changed defaults for UI snapshot testing: snapshots now serialize with stable key ordering, and obsolete snapshots fail the run instead of warning. On-call: if a pipeline breaks tonight, it's almost certainly stale snapshots, not a regression. The new default values the runner ships with are as follows.

settings of fafog-haduf:
ZORIX_PIN=4648
ZORIX_METRICS_HOST=metrics.zorix.paliqsys.corp
ZORIX_LOG_LEVEL=info
ZORIX_TENANT=druix

Before sealing the ceremony record for the Hushwire alert deduplicator, confirm that both witnesses have initialed the custody log and that the dedupe engine's signing key was generated on the air-gapped terminal, not a support laptop. Support staff should note that future lockouts of the deduplicator's admin account are resolved only with the material produced at this step. Verify the terminal screen matches the printed transcript, then record the recovery passphrase exactly as displayed below.

strongbox words: sorir-belvan-rusix-ulays-ralmir-praix-eliir-tamax-praael-druael-julir-tamius-jorir

Handover: Quickbasket checkout load tests

Taking over from me? Short version: load tests run against the Fennwick staging cluster, never prod. Target is 400 checkouts/min sustained, 900 burst. Known flake: payment stub times out above 600/min — raise its pool size before blaming the gateway. Results land in the perf dashboard; archive runs older than 30 days. Last full run passed on the v2.8 candidate. Don't change ramp profiles without telling the payments crew. The harness currently runs with the values below.

settings of yageg-yahap:
[gorael]
team = olieth
access_code = ac_941d74
owner = brieth.aldiel
host = gorael.tolvaqio.internal
port = 6379
peer = briwyn.urlaqtech.internal
salt = 116e6622
pin = 1957

- [ ] Review the Tallgrove stale-cache postmortem before proceeding: confirm the Merrow cache invalidation fix is deployed and no ceremony host serves stale key material. Verify cache TTLs match the remediation doc. Once confirmed, unseal the ceremony workstation; the required recovery passphrase appears on the following line.

vault phrase of bagaf-kajeg = jorath-feniel-briir-siliel-ralix